At its core, DoneEx VBACompiler is not just an add-in; it is a conversion engine. It takes your standard Excel workbook containing VBA code and compiles it into a standalone executable file (.exe).

Unlike a standard Excel file, this compiled executable runs in its own protected memory space. For the end-user, the difference is night and day: the application feels like professional software, not a macro-enabled spreadsheet.

No VBA editing – Once compiled, you cannot modify code without recompiling from the original source. Keep your source .xlsm secure and recompile for updates. If you sell Excel tools, you face a

No direct printing from VBA – Some printer control via VBA may require adjustments. Test printing workflows before distribution.

No ribbon customization – Compiled executables use a minimal interface. Design your UI using worksheet controls and forms instead.
